版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据库培训PPT汇报人:XX目录01数据库基础概念02数据库设计原理03SQL语言应用04数据库安全与维护05数据库案例分析06数据库新技术趋势数据库基础概念01数据库定义数据库是按照特定数据模型组织、存储和管理数据的仓库,支持高效的数据存取。数据存储结构数据库管理系统提供数据定义、数据操作、数据控制和数据维护等核心功能。数据管理功能数据库设计强调数据的物理独立性和逻辑独立性,以适应数据结构的变化。数据独立性数据库类型关系型数据库如MySQL和Oracle,以表格形式存储数据,支持复杂的查询和事务处理。关系型数据库非关系型数据库如MongoDB和Redis,适用于大数据和实时Web应用,提供灵活的数据模型。非关系型数据库分布式数据库如Google的Spanner,允许多个物理位置的数据存储和处理,提高系统的可扩展性和可靠性。分布式数据库数据库管理系统数据库管理系统负责数据的物理存储,如数据文件的组织和存储方式,确保数据的高效访问。数据库的存储结构事务管理确保数据库操作的原子性、一致性、隔离性和持久性,是数据库管理系统的关键组成部分。事务管理SQL是数据库管理系统中用于数据查询、更新、插入和删除的标准语言,是数据库操作的核心。数据操作语言010203数据库管理系统数据库管理系统通过锁机制和多版本并发控制等技术,管理多个用户同时对数据库的访问和修改。并发控制数据库管理系统提供数据备份和恢复机制,以防止数据丢失和系统故障时能够快速恢复数据。数据恢复与备份数据库设计原理02数据模型概念数据模型如ER模型,用于描述实体间关系,是数据库设计的蓝图,便于理解业务需求。概念数据模型逻辑数据模型如关系模型,定义数据存储结构和数据间关系,是实现数据库设计的关键步骤。逻辑数据模型物理数据模型关注数据在存储介质上的具体实现,包括索引、存储过程等,直接影响性能。物理数据模型数据库规范化规范化旨在减少数据冗余和依赖,提高数据库的逻辑结构,确保数据的一致性和完整性。01规范化的目标要求数据库表的每一列都是不可分割的基本数据项,确保每个字段值都是原子性的。02第一范式(1NF)在1NF的基础上,消除部分函数依赖,确保表中所有非主属性完全依赖于主键。03第二范式(2NF)在2NF的基础上,消除传递依赖,即非主属性不依赖于其他非主属性,保证数据的独立性。04第三范式(3NF)是3NF的加强版,要求表中每个决定因素都包含主键,进一步减少数据冗余和更新异常。05BCNF范式数据库设计步骤在设计数据库前,首先要进行需求分析,明确系统需要存储哪些数据以及数据间的关系。需求分析将设计好的数据库在实际环境中部署,并进行测试,确保满足性能和功能需求。实施与测试将概念模型转换为具体的数据库逻辑模型,如关系模型,并定义表结构和数据类型。逻辑设计通过ER模型等工具,将需求分析的结果转化为概念模型,形成初步的数据库结构。概念设计根据逻辑设计的结果,确定数据存储方式、索引策略和存储参数等物理层面的细节。物理设计SQL语言应用03SQL基础语法01SELECT语句用于从数据库中检索数据,如SELECT*FROMtable_name获取表中所有数据。02INSERT语句用于向数据库表中插入新的数据行,例如INSERTINTOtable_name(column1,column2)VALUES(value1,value2)。数据查询语句SELECT数据操作语句INSERTSQL基础语法01数据更新语句UPDATEUPDATE语句用于修改数据库表中的现有数据,如UPDATEtable_nameSETcolumn1=value1WHEREcondition。02数据删除语句DELETEDELETE语句用于删除数据库表中的数据,例如DELETEFROMtable_nameWHEREcondition用于删除满足特定条件的记录。数据查询与操作使用SELECT语句从数据库中检索数据,如SELECT*FROMemployees获取员工信息。基本SELECT语句0102通过WHERE子句实现条件筛选,例如SELECT*FROMordersWHEREstatus='pending'筛选待处理订单。条件查询03利用聚合函数如COUNT(),SUM(),AVG()等对数据进行统计分析,如计算总销售额。聚合函数应用数据查询与操作使用ORDERBY子句对查询结果进行排序,例如SELECT*FROMproductsORDERBYpriceASC按价格升序排列。数据排序通过GROUPBY和HAVING子句对数据进行分组和条件筛选,如SELECTdepartment,AVG(salary)FROMemployeesGROUPBYdepartmentHAVINGAVG(salary)>50000。数据分组与汇总SQL高级功能子查询允许在SELECT、INSERT、UPDATE和DELETE语句中嵌套使用,以实现复杂的数据检索和操作。子查询事务确保数据库操作的原子性,通过BEGIN、COMMIT和ROLLBACK语句管理数据的完整性和一致性。事务处理通过JOIN语句可以将多个表中的数据根据共同字段进行关联,实现数据的整合和分析。联结操作010203SQL高级功能01存储过程是一组为了完成特定功能的SQL语句集,可以被存储在数据库中,通过调用执行。存储过程02触发器是数据库中自动执行的程序,用于在特定的数据库事件发生时,如INSERT或UPDATE,自动执行预定义的操作。触发器数据库安全与维护04数据库备份与恢复实施定期备份是数据库维护的关键,如每周或每月自动备份,确保数据安全。定期备份策略定期进行数据恢复测试,确保备份数据的完整性和恢复流程的有效性。数据恢复测试增量备份仅备份自上次备份以来更改的数据,而全备份则复制整个数据库,各有优势。增量备份与全备份制定详细的灾难恢复计划,包括备份数据的存储位置、恢复步骤和责任人。灾难恢复计划对备份数据进行加密,以防止数据在存储或传输过程中被未授权访问。备份数据的加密数据库安全策略实施严格的用户身份验证和权限分配,确保只有授权用户才能访问敏感数据。访问控制管理01采用先进的加密算法对存储和传输中的数据进行加密,防止数据泄露和未授权访问。数据加密技术02定期进行数据库安全审计,检查潜在的安全漏洞,确保数据库系统的安全性和完整性。定期安全审计03性能优化技巧合理创建和管理索引可以显著提高数据库查询效率,减少数据检索时间。索引优化优化SQL查询语句,避免全表扫描,使用更有效的查询条件和连接方式。查询优化编写高效的存储过程,减少网络传输和客户端处理负担,提升数据库操作性能。存储过程优化设置定期的数据库维护任务,如重建索引、更新统计信息,以保持数据库性能稳定。定期维护任务数据库案例分析05实际应用案例沃尔玛利用数据库系统实时追踪库存,优化供应链,减少缺货和过剩问题。01花旗银行使用数据库分析客户信用历史,进行风险评估,以制定贷款策略。02Coursera通过分析用户数据库,了解学习习惯,个性化推荐课程,提高用户满意度。03梅奥诊所使用数据库存储患者信息,进行疾病模式分析,提高诊断和治疗效率。04零售业库存管理银行信贷风险评估在线教育平台用户行为分析医疗健康数据管理常见问题解决分析慢查询日志,通过索引优化、查询重写等手段提升数据库性能。性能优化策略利用事务日志和备份恢复机制,确保数据在故障后能够恢复到一致状态。数据一致性维护定期更新数据库系统,打补丁修复已知的安全漏洞,防止数据泄露和攻击。安全漏洞修补案例讨论与总结通过分析案例,学习如何运用数据库理论解决实际问题,如数据模型设计、查询优化等。案例分析方法论讨论案例中出现的常见数据库问题,例如数据冗余、索引失效,以及解决方案。案例中的常见问题总结案例成功实施数据库管理的关键要素,如需求分析、系统设计、团队协作等。案例成功要素总结从失败的数据库案例中提取教训,分析导致问题的根本原因,为未来提供参考。案例教训与启示数据库新技术趋势06大数据与数据库随着大数据量级的增加,分布式数据库如HadoopHBase和Cassandra成为处理海量数据的关键技术。分布式数据库的崛起NoSQL数据库如MongoDB和Couchbase因其灵活的数据模型和水平扩展能力,在大数据场景中得到广泛应用。NoSQL数据库的普及流处理技术如ApacheKafka和ApacheFlink的兴起,使得数据库能够实时处理和分析数据流。实时数据处理010203云数据库服务01云数据库的弹性扩展云数据库服务允许用户根据需求动态调整资源,如AmazonRDS可实现无缝扩展。02多租户架构优势云数据库如GoogleCloudSQL支持多租户架构,提高资源利用率,降低成本。03数据安全与合规性云服务提供商如MicrosoftAzure提供高级加密和合规性认证,确保数据安全。04自动化备份与恢复云数据库服务通
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- GB/T 46928-2025动植物油脂甘油一酯、甘油二酯、甘油三酯和甘油的测定高效体积排阻色谱法(HPSEC)
- 2025年高职邮政通信管理(邮政运营规范)试题及答案
- 2025年高职中医学(中医辨证论治)试题及答案
- 2025年中职畜禽生产技术(肉鸡养殖管理)试题及答案
- 2025年中职(市场营销基础)市场调研综合测试题及答案
- 2025年高职园林绿化工程(园林绿化施工)试题及答案
- 2026年房产咨询教学(房产咨询应用)试题及答案
- 2025年中职环境工程(固体废物处理基础)试题及答案
- 2025年中职(烹饪工艺)中式面点创新制作试题及答案
- 2026年冷链物流(运输案例)试题及答案
- 设备管理奖罚管理制度
- ab股权协议书范本
- 工程造价审计服务投标方案(技术方案)
- 蟹苗买卖合同协议
- 胸外科手术围手术期的护理
- 全球著名空港产业发展案例解析
- 科技领域安全风险评估及保障措施
- 锅炉水质化验记录表(完整版)
- 钢筋工劳务合同
- 仓储物流行业普洛斯分析报告
- DB33T 2188.3-2019 大型赛会志愿服务岗位规范 第3部分:抵离迎送志愿服务
评论
0/150
提交评论